Green Mission
First Parish in Concord was featured in a December 7, 2008 Boston Globe article titled "Green Mission: Churches under renovation using methods that are environmentally friendly". The article highlighted the following environmentally friendly changes in the construction project:
- New floors made of linseed oil and jute, and carpeting made of high recycled content
- Exterior siding made of natural, sustainably harvested, cedar wood
- Separate ventilation system monitoring CO2 level that varies supply of fresh air to meet real-time interior air quality needs and conserve energy
- Multiple, separate temperature zones to better conserve energy
- Low-flush toilets and low-flow faucets in sinks
- High-efficiency light fixtures
- Argon-filled windows, with double-pane insulating glass and low-emissivity coating
- New drainage system redirected into new subsurface drainage chambers instead of directly running off into Mill Brook
